ASUS Vivobook 17 Series model M712DA-AU188T contains DDR4-SDRAM memory with one SO-DIMM slot available for upgrade. The laptop features on-board memory combined with one upgradeable SO-DIMM slot. Maximum RAM capacity reaches 12 GB total. Memory operates at 2400 MHz frequency. Compatible upgrade modules must match DDR4-SDRAM specifications and SO-DIMM form factor to ensure proper installation and system compatibility.

Memory Upgrade Specifications

SpecificationValue
Memory slots1x SO-DIMM
Form factorOn-board + SO-DIMM
Memory typeDDR4-SDRAM
Frequency2400 MHz
Maximum RAM12 GB
Voltage1.2V
Number of pins260-pin
InterfacePC4
PC Speed RatingPC4-2400 (PC4-19200)
Bandwidth19.2 GB/s
Laptop Release date07 March 2020
